An explosion occurred in a residential building in Novorossiysk.
The incident occurred on Tuesday evening, August 20. According to preliminary information, one person died and several were injured.
An explosion was heard on the Anapa highway in Novorossiysk. Some media reported that it was a domestic gas explosion.

But RIA Novosti, citing a source in law enforcement agencies, reports that it was presumably an RGD grenade that exploded. This happened in a residential building on the thirteenth floor.
It is specified that a combat anti-personnel fragmentation grenade ended up in the hands of minors. One of the teenagers detonated it.
As a result, one child died. Three more were injured to varying degrees of severity and were hospitalized.
An investigation is underway into the incident, and the circumstances of the incident are being established. Emergency services are working at the scene of the emergency.
